# Donation-receipt mailer for the Larkspur Giving Fund.
# Heads up, support folks: receipts batch every few minutes, so a
# "missing receipt" is usually just queued. Retry limits and send
# windows live here — tweak cautiously, donors notice duplicates
# more than delays. The knobs we currently run with are right below.

tuning table, fawip-fahag:
WEIGHTS = {
    "novwyn": 452,
    "casdor": 675,
}

## Changelog — Pixelforge 3.2

Defaults changed for the thumbnail generation queue. Max concurrent workers dropped from 8 to 4; retry backoff is now exponential. Plugins relying on the old flat retry interval must set it explicitly. Oversized source images now fail fast instead of queuing. The new default configuration is as follows.

settings of tagef-bawif:
DRUIX_HOST=druix.zemvarlabs.internal
DRUIX_PORT=8000

**Step 4: Queue worker rollout.** Quick heads-up for review: the ProctorFlow exam queue drains through the Vexlar relay, and workers refuse unsigned session bundles. That's deliberate — it stops replayed exam sessions from sneaking back in. Before you approve the deploy, confirm the signer matches what's baked into the relay config. The deploy key follows below.

deploy key for kajof-fajop: bky6_gDHw9Q

Handover note — Pinwheel config hot-reload. Taking over from me: the reload watcher picks up changes to plugin config files within about ten seconds, no restart needed, but nested keys under the transport section still require a full restart. Plugin authors keep hitting that. The watcher currently runs with these settings.

deployment values, kajeg-kajep:
wenix:
  pin: 6332
  metrics_host: metrics.wenix.tolvaqlabs.internal
  tenant: ulaax
  seal: seal_74e75f1d

Handover Note — Budget Request, Orvane Platform. Welcome aboard! Main live item is the Q2 budget request for the Orvane platform rebuild: 480k asked, roughly 390k likely approved. Finance wants the phasing split across two quarters — I've half-drafted that in the shared folder. Push back gently on the hosting line; it's padded. Marta in procurement is your ally here. Context for why this matters sits in the note below.

confidential, kagup-bafog: Fraaxax Group is in early talks to buy Soroxox Group for about $343.8 million. The Olidor launch date is June 14, and nothing goes to the press before then. Legal wants the Aldmirek Logistics term sheet signed before July 23.